debuginstall: show directory for Python lib
Example new output
on Windows:
$ hg debuginstall
checking encoding (cp1252)...
checking Python lib (C:\Users\adi\hgrepos\hg-main\hg-python\lib)...
checking installed modules (C:\Users\adi\hgrepos\hg-main\mercurial)...
checking templates (C:\Users\adi\hgrepos\hg-main\mercurial\templates)...
checking commit editor...
C:\Program Files (x86)\Notepad++\notepad++.exe
checking username...
no problems detected
on Linux:
adi@kork-ubuntu64:~/hgrepos/hg-main$ ./hg debuginstall
checking encoding (UTF-8)...
checking Python lib (/usr/lib/python2.7)...
checking installed modules (/home/adi/hgrepos/hg-main/mercurial)...
checking templates (/home/adi/hgrepos/hg-main/mercurial/templates)...
checking commit editor...
checking username...
no problems detected

#!/bin/sh # # This is an example of using HGEDITOR to create of diff to review the # changes while commiting. # If you want to pass your favourite editor some other parameters # only for Mercurial, modify this: case "${EDITOR}" in "") EDITOR="vi" ;; emacs) EDITOR="$EDITOR -nw" ;; gvim|vim) EDITOR="$EDITOR -f -o" ;; esac HGTMP="" cleanup_exit() { rm -rf "$HGTMP" } # Remove temporary files even if we get interrupted trap "cleanup_exit" 0 # normal exit trap "exit 255" HUP INT QUIT ABRT TERM HGTMP=$(mktemp -d ${TMPDIR-/tmp}/hgeditor.XXXXXX) [ x$HGTMP != x -a -d $HGTMP ] || { echo "Could not create temporary directory! Exiting." 1>&2 exit 1 } ( grep '^HG: changed' "$1" | cut -b 13- | while read changed; do "$HG" diff "$changed" >> "$HGTMP/diff" done ) cat "$1" > "$HGTMP/msg" MD5=$(which md5sum 2>/dev/null) || \ MD5=$(which md5 2>/dev/null) [ -x "${MD5}" ] && CHECKSUM=`${MD5} "$HGTMP/msg"` if [ -s "$HGTMP/diff" ]; then $EDITOR "$HGTMP/msg" "$HGTMP/diff" || exit $? else $EDITOR "$HGTMP/msg" || exit $? fi [ -x "${MD5}" ] && (echo "$CHECKSUM" | ${MD5} -c >/dev/null 2>&1 && exit 13) mv "$HGTMP/msg" "$1" exit $?
